Minden is a 4 MW hydro power plant in Canada, operated by Orillia Power Generation Corp since its commissioning. Ranked #486 of 612 hydro plants in Canada, Minden's 4 MW represents 0.004% of Canada's total hydro capacity of 102,715 MW. The largest hydro plant in Canada is Centrale Robert-Bourassa at 5,616 MW, making Minden 1,404 times smaller. Nearby plants within 50 km include Goodlight (10 MW, Solar), Balsam Lake (3 MW, Solar), and Fenelon Falls (2.6 MW, Hydro). The facility is located in Ontario, approximately 150 km from Toronto.

Zero Direct Emissions
Minden is a hydro power plant producing approximately 14 GWh of clean electricity per year with zero direct CO₂ emissions during operation.
Lifecycle emissions: ~24 g CO₂/kWh (manufacturing, transport, decommissioning)
